Champions Trophy 2025, ICC Meeting Highlights: The moment of reckoning for Champions Trophy 2025 has come as far as its scheduling is concerned. The International Cricket Council (ICC) will be holding an emergency board meeting today (29 November, Friday) with all the full-time members including the Pakistan Cricket Board (PCB) and the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I) to decide the future of the tournament. The Champions Trophy 2025 ICC meeting will reportedly take place virtually at 2.30 PM Dubai time (4.00 PM IST) on 29 November (Friday) 2024.
The fate of Champions Trophy 2025 has been in limbo ever since BCCI refused to send the Indian cricket team to Pakistan for the tournament due to security issues. PCB’s tough stance on the matter where they have refused to accept a Hybrid Model has created an unwanted standoff. The ICC, meanwhile, has failed to meet its contractual obligation of releasing the schedule 100 days before the tournament and now faces legal threats from the broadcasters.
In such a scenario, the ICC was forced to call for an emergency board meeting where it was reported that the members could be asked to vote for or against the Hybrid Model. if things go out of hand then Pakistan can also lose the hosting rights. However, ICC is trying to find a middle ground by offering extra financial incentives to PCB and making them ready for a Hybrid Model where India matches will be played outside of Pakistan. A similar model was followed during Asia Cup 2023.
Champions Trophy 2025 teams list
A total of eight teams – India, Pakistan, Australia, South Africa, New Zealand, Afghanistan, England and Bangladesh – will take part in the Champions Trophy 2025.
Champions Trophy 2025 schedule
The Champions Trophy 2025 is expected to take place between 19 February and 9 March across three stadiums in Pakistan. The three venues are Karachi, Rawalpindi, and Lahore.
